In the fall of 1998 I was in a small business trade show in Thorold,
ON and I wanted a way to get the names of the people who came
by my booth. I thought that an electronic newsletter would be
a good way to do it. I had 7 people sign up and The PC Improvement
News was born. With such a small number of subscribers, I did
everything from my email client. When I got to around 100 I thought
I'd give ListBot a try. I
stayed with them until I had around 500 subscribers. By that time
I was on my second hosting provider, and my package included use
of a list server program on their server. I switched to that one,
and that is where it stands today.
